Transaction 75e1a19bec20f735dc201a9e707934082387164de5a0099437d920ecddfc4076

1 Input
2 Outputs
  • 75e1a19bec20f735dc201a9e707934082387164de5a0099437d920ecddfc4076:0
  • value  634842
    address  3F8tNJiVHpCXga28GhLv9u8yRXUfk2CtQ1
  • 75e1a19bec20f735dc201a9e707934082387164de5a0099437d920ecddfc4076:1
  • value  1290823
    address  1LKAKT3m2gMDxiy8ZuVUBxqrFzC87T6LdJ